3M
3M is a diversified manufacturing company with
operations in more than 60 countries and employs
more than 71,000 people worldwide. The company
currently uses nearly all languages of Norton
AntiVirusincluding Spanish, French, German,
Portuguese, Korean, Chinese, and Japaneseto
protect its approximately 44,000 workstations
around the world.

A key factor in winning the 3M evaluation process
was Symantec’s reputation for quality customer
service worldwide, which includes around-the-
clock backing by the Symantec AntiVirus Research
Center(SARC). In order to stay ahead of the
accelerating proliferation of new computer viruses,
SARC offers customer support through fully
staffed research centers in the Americas, Europe,
and Asia Pacific.
